- May 08, 2022 · 3 years agoThe required number of confirmations for Bitcoin transactions depends on the level of security you require. Generally, it is recommended to wait for at least 6 confirmations, which takes approximately 1 hour. This ensures that the transaction is highly unlikely to be reversed or double-spent. However, for smaller transactions or when time is of the essence, some merchants and exchanges may accept transactions with fewer confirmations. It ultimately depends on the risk tolerance of the recipient.
- May 08, 2022 · 3 years agoWhen it comes to Bitcoin transactions, confirmations refer to the number of blocks that have been added to the blockchain after the block containing your transaction. Each confirmation increases the level of security and reduces the risk of a transaction being reversed. While 6 confirmations is the general recommendation, it's important to note that the more confirmations, the more secure the transaction becomes. So, if you're dealing with a large amount of Bitcoin, it's wise to wait for more confirmations before considering the transaction as fully secure.
